Food Bank Network of Somerset County
August 4, 2026

(August 4, 2026) BRIDGEWATER, NJ – Yesterday, Congressman Tom Kean, Jr. (NJ-07) met with Bridgewater Councilman Michael Kirsch, Deputy Township Administrator Rob Field, and Food Bank Network of Somerset County Executive Director Steve Katz to visit the Food Bank Network of Somerset County. Congressman Kean secured $420,000 in a House Appropriations bill for the facility through the FY27 Community Project Funding process. This funding will be used to obtain and maintain a cold storage and a food locker unit.

MOVE Act
August 3, 2026

(August 3, 2026) WASHINGTON, D.C. – Today, Congressman Tom Kean, Jr. (NJ-07) introduced the Making Ownership Viable for Everyone (MOVE) Act, legislation that would make portable mortgages accessible, allowing homeowners to transfer their existing mortgage rate, term, and balance to a new property.
